  1. Anticorrosive carbon steel tanks are widely used in chemical production as common production equipment. However, due to the effects of corrosive factors such as carbon steel materials and some corrosive media such as corrosive media, carbon steel tanks have different degrees of corrosion during use. Doing a good job in anti -corrosion work is of great significance to promote the development of new technologies, save materials, extend the service life of equipment, ensure safety production, and reduce environmental pollution. The quality of anticorrosive engineering directly affects production safety and economic benefits. Therefore, it is necessary to use suitable anti -corrosion materials to protect them. As an important variety of anticorrosive materials, coatings are widely used in the anticorrosion and decoration of carbon steel storage tanks because of its economy, easy construction, and good anticorrosive effects.

    The inner wall anti -corrosive coatings of carbon steel tanks are different from other industrial coatings. It must meet two requirements: first, it must have excellent rust resistance to steel. The layer is in the state of liquid products, and the immersion state is more conducive to corrosive medium penetration through the paint film and corrodes steel. Second, it must be soaked in liquid products for many years, and the paint film cannot be foam, does not fall off, does not pollute products or induce product deterioration.
